A positive integer is called a rising number If its digits form a strictly increasing sequence. for example, 1457 is a rising number, 3438 is not a rising number, and neither 2334.
Questions: How many 3-digit rising numbers are there where 3 is the middle digit? (solved) How many three-digit rising numbers are there?
